UK and US authorities investigating a “dark web” child pornography site run from South Korea on Wednesday announced the arrest of 337 suspects in 38 countries. Britain’s National Crime Agency (NCA) said the “Welcome to Video” site contained 250,000 videos that were downloaded a million times by users across the world. The Times found that there was a close relationship between the center and Silicon Valley that raised questions about good governance practices. For example, the center receives both money and in-kind donations from tech companies, while employees of the same companies are sometimes members of its board. Google alone has donated nearly $4 million in the past decade, according to public testimony.

Not all mass thefts of data facilitated by the dark web have been motivated by money. National Security Agency (NSA) contractor Edward Snowden, who was concerned about the extent of government surveillance, used Tor to coordinate with journalists on leaking 1.5 million classified government documents. The publicizing of Snowden’s actions led to a global spike of interest in Tor and a resulting rapid expansion of the network’s user base. In addition to traditionally forbidden trade, the dark web became a hub for the sale of stolen information. Credit card and social security numbers are routinely purchased, as are passwords for e-mail accounts—sometimes en masse. In March 2012 Russian hacker Yevgeniy Nikulin and three accomplices stole passwords for 117 million e-mail addresses from the social media company LinkedIn and then offered the data for sale on the dark web.

The Tor network also gave hackers, terrorists, and distributors of illegal pornography a secure method of communication. The term dark web first appeared in print in a 2009 newspaper article describing these criminal applications.
